Have a garage or yard sale:
This is probably one of the easiest and quickest ways to generate some cash flow.
When preparing for your sale, consider those items in your home that have not been used for a year or longer to add to your sell items. Generally, if an item hasn’t been used or a piece of clothing hasn’t been worn in a year or more, the likelihood of it being used is pretty slim. Advertising your sale well is key to having a successful sale and high turn-out. Consider placing signs around the area in which you live guiding people from major intersections to your residence. Many people opt to use boxes with the directions written on them and weigh the box down by adding a heavy object such as a rock instead of hanging up paper signs. Advertise in any newspaper publications that don’t charge to place an ad. These can be local publications as well as on-line publications specific to your area. Make sure the items you are selling have been cleaned up nicely. Display your items in an appealing manner. If you can try to place a price tag on most items. Be sure to have adequate change the morning of the sale. Advertise the sale to take place on Saturday as well as on Sunday. Many garage sales are also held on Fridays.
Visit a couple pawn shops in your area:
Gold jewelry is a hot item right now with the pawn shops. Most accept pieces that are broken since its the gold content they are after. Rummage through all your jewelry for pieces you no longer wear or want as well as those broken pieces. Be sure to bargain with the pawn shops and don’t accept the first offer. This is what their business is about, bargaining and getting the most by paying the least. Pawn shops often pay different amounts for the same item so try to comparison shop. Pawn shops can be interested in many different types of items. It doesn’t hurt to at least show them what you have since gold isn’t the only item their interested in.
Hold A Fund Raiser:
What about a bake sale, a cook off or a raffle? Make sure what your selling is easy and inexpensive to make. Keep the cost of the items for people to purchase at $1.00 or under. Car washes work well for fund raisers and the over-head is hardly costs anything, meaning the money made is virtually all profit. Fund raisers are good events to get the kids involved with.
Sell Your Books To Used Book Stores:
Often times more money can be paid per book by selling to a used book store than what it can be sold for on Amazon or EBay. The reason for this is the number of books being sold on these sites for a penny. If you have a number of books you no longer want, take them to one or two local used book stores. What one store doesn’t purchase, the next one just might. Just as with the pawn shops, be sure to bargain with the used book stores and don’t accept their first offer.
Sell Your Unwanted Clothing To Used Clothes Stores:
If you have some nicer pieces of clothing such as ones that have never been worn, still have the tags attached, or are higher end/brand named pieces, you might consider selling those to used clothing stores or second hand boutiques instead of at your garage sale. Remember at garage sales, the prices must be very low. This is just the nature of garage sales. You might be giving away your finer pieces of clothing at a garage sale that could bring you a decent offer from a used clothing store or boutique. Infant and children’s clothing is always is demand at children’s second hand clothing stores. Make sure the clothing pieces don’t have stains or require mending. You will receive better offers for items that are clean, stain-free, don’t require any mending and are wrinkle-free.
